SOMEBODY PLEASE HELP ME I ONLY HAVE TILL 11;59<br> how did william c nell impact society??
kap26 [50]

Answer:

William C. Nell was an African American civic activist, abolitionist, and historian. He was also a founding member of the New England Freedom Association in 1842, a black Boston organization that assisted fugitive slaves in their efforts to gain freedom.
